Mark letter A, B, C or D to indicate the sentence that is closest in meaning to the given one.

1. Nobody has invited her to the party.

A. No one has been invited to the party.

B. She has invited nobody to the party.

C. Nobody has given a party to her.

D. She hasn't been invited to the party.

2.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

2 mins • 1 pt

Mark letter A, B, C or D to indicate the sentence that is closest in meaning to the given one.

2. You have to finish your homework on time.

A. Your homework has to be finished on time.

B. Your homework is finished on time.

C. Your homework has been finished on time.

D. Your homework have to be finished on time.

3.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

2 mins • 1 pt

Mark letter A, B, C or D to indicate the sentence that is closest in meaning to the given one.

3. I always give my mother flowers on Mother’s Day.

A. Flowers are always given by my mother on Mother’s Day.

B. My mother is always given flowers on Mother’s Day

C. My mother always is given flowers on Mother’s Day.

D. My mother is given always flowers on Mother’s Day.

4.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

2 mins • 1 pt

Mark letter A, B, C or D to indicate the sentence that is closest in meaning to the given one.

4. Thousands of people have to build that castle for him for years.

A. That castle has to be built for him for years by thousands of people.

B. That castle has to be build for him by thousands of people for years.

C. That castle have to be built for him by thousands of people for years.

D. That castle has to build for him by thousands of people for years.

5.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

2 mins • 1 pt

Mark letter A, B, C or D to indicate the sentence that is closest in meaning to the given one.

5. Typhoon Faxai hit the Japanese Capital and surrounding regions on Monday.

A. The Japanese Capital and surrounding regions were hit by Typhoon Faxai on Monday.

B. The Japanese Capital and surrounding regions was hit by Typhoon Faxai on Monday.

C. The Japanese Capital and surrounding regions had been hit by Typhoon Faxai on Monday.

D. The Japanese Capital and surrounding regions are hit by Typhoon Faxai on Monday.

6.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

2 mins • 1 pt

Mark letter A, B, C or D to indicate the sentence that is closest in meaning to the given one.

6. People have reported that Son Doong cave is the biggest in the world.

A. It have been reported that Son Doong cave is the biggest in the world.

B. It is reported that Son Doong cave is the biggest in the world.

C. Son Doong cave is reported to have been the biggest in the world.

D. It has been reported that Son Doong cave is the biggest in the world.

7.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

2 mins • 1 pt

Mark letter A, B, C or D to indicate the sentence that is closest in meaning to the given one.

7. They reported that the troops were coming.

A. It was being reported that the troops were coming.

B. It was reported that the troops to be coming.

C. It had been reported that the troops were coming.

D. It was reported that the troops were coming.
